Output bc8598924b74b01b4342e4f8b19ba2939a71819dafc82cd29a82d70215e022c6:2

value
60900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a21de042810a6d6d54e2f367fe5e4b8e4eaf3d12 OP_EQUAL
address
3GUDBSbkE6KHN4Wez2PfgnMHwBQcT8c7Bt
transaction
bc8598924b74b01b4342e4f8b19ba2939a71819dafc82cd29a82d70215e022c6
spent
true